How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Stuyvesant Heights?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Stuyvesant Heights Studio Apartments | $3,847 | $1,650 | $6,884 |
| Stuyvesant Heights 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,582 | $1,200 | $10,000+ |
Stuyvesant Heights 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,776 | $2,500 | $8,633 |
| Stuyvesant Heights 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,091 | $1,500 | $8,961 |
| Stuyvesant Heights 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,323 | $4,000 | $9,995 |
